Speaking:
There are two methods to sign-up.
 
  • To speak at a specific council meeting, you can sign up at 9 AM outside the council chambers to speak on specific agenda items, which are usually open to public input.  Unfortunately, this week's agenda is pretty much closed to public comment, which is no accident.
  • If you do speak to a specific agenda item, you should stay with the topic on hand, but you should tie the agenda item in with your issues of trust and leadership in the city goverment.
  •  The following week's city council meeting requires you to sign up at the auditor's office (in City Hall) by Thursday afternoon.  You can speak on any topic that you wish for three minutes. 

With any questions, contact the City Auditor's Office by e-mail, or call 503-823-4078

 
 
Note that you may not speak to Consent Agenda items.
